Windows Tips & News

Windows Subsystem for Linux tem aceleração de hardware para vídeo

RECOMENDADO: Clique aqui para corrigir problemas do Windows e otimizar o desempenho do sistema

A Microsoft anunciou hoje que o WSL agora oferece suporte à codificação e decodificação de vídeo por hardware. A implementação possibilita o uso de processamento de hardware, codificação e decodificação de vídeo em qualquer aplicativo que suporte VAAPI. O acima é suportado para placas gráficas AMD, Intel e NVIDIA.

Propaganda

Aplicativos populares que suportam VAAPI são FFmpeg e GStreamer. Com a aceleração de hardware de vídeo, os aplicativos não sobrecarregarão a CPU e delegarão as operações de codificação e decodificação à GPU. Isso aumenta o desempenho, reduz o consumo de energia e o ruído do PC. Por fim, mais recursos de CPU estarão disponíveis para WSL e aplicativos regulares do Windows, aumentando o desempenho geral. Além disso, a resolução do vídeo no WSL aumenta graças ao novo recurso.

Aceleração de vídeo na WSL
Gstreamer no WSL realizando composição de mistura alfa acelerada por GPU e renderização em uma janela X11

O processamento de vídeo da GPU em um ambiente Linux habilitado para WSL é fornecido por meio do back-end D3D12 e do front-end VAAPI no pacote Mesa, interagindo com a API D3D12 usando a biblioteca DxCore. Ele permite que os aplicativos obtenham o mesmo nível de acesso à GPU que os aplicativos nativos do Windows.

A Microsoft mencionou os requisitos para que tudo funcione. Você precisa de uma distro como o Ubuntu 22.04.1 LTS com systemd ativado e WSL 1.1 e mais recente.

O seguinte hardware é suportado.

Fornecedor Plataformas suportadas Versão mínima do driver de vídeo
AMD Série Radeon RX 5000 ou superior

Série Ryzen 4000 ou superior

Adrenalina 23.3.1

ETA março de 2023

Intel Família de processadores Intel® Core™ de 11ª geração (codinome Tiger Lake, Rocket Lake)

Família de processadores Intel® Core™ de 12ª geração (codinome Alder Lake)

Família de processadores Intel® Core™ de 13ª geração (codinome Raptor Lake)

Família de gráficos dedicados Intel® Iris® Xe (codinome DG1)

Família de gráficos Intel® Arc® (codinome Alchemist)

31.0.101.4032
nvidia Série GeForce GTX 10 e mais recente

Série GeForce RTX 20 e mais recente

Quadro RTX

NVIDIA RTX

526.47

Você encontrará mais detalhes e instruções no anúncio oficial vinculado aqui.

RECOMENDADO: Clique aqui para corrigir problemas do Windows e otimizar o desempenho do sistema

Se você gostou deste artigo, compartilhe-o usando os botões abaixo. Não vai exigir muito de você, mas vai nos ajudar a crescer. Obrigado por seu apoio!

Propaganda

Como redefinir as configurações do Mozilla Firefox

Como redefinir as configurações do Mozilla Firefox

RECOMENDADO: Clique aqui para corrigir problemas do Windows e otimizar o desempenho do sistemaSe ...

Consulte Mais informação

Qual é a diferença entre Edge, Edge Beta, Edge Dev e Edge Canary?

Qual é a diferença entre Edge, Edge Beta, Edge Dev e Edge Canary?

A Microsoft lançou a primeira versão pública do navegador Edge baseado em Chromium há pouco mais ...

Consulte Mais informação

Como ativar o preenchimento automático no Microsoft Authenticator

Como ativar o preenchimento automático no Microsoft Authenticator

Como ativar o preenchimento automático no Microsoft Authenticator.O Microsoft Authenticator obtém...

Consulte Mais informação